L6_membrane


Accession number: PF05805
L6 membrane protein

This family consists of several eukaryotic L6 membrane proteins. L6, IL-TMP, and TM4SF5 are cell surface proteins predicted to have four transmembrane domains. Previous sequence analysis led to their assignment as members of the tetraspanin superfamily it has now been found that that they are not significantly related to genuine tetraspanins, but instead constitute their own L6 family [1]. Several members of this family have been implicated in human cancer [2,3].
